Output 26e310b86394f2f3844c1021e6bdf5f7063030e49d3198d43c44b6b756b35acf:1

value
500000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b51b1d3b573cf2057bb8b59f3bc1d5058f3604d2 OP_EQUAL
address
3JCciC5QKKNNX4G24BoG6siQM23Uc7g93L
transaction
26e310b86394f2f3844c1021e6bdf5f7063030e49d3198d43c44b6b756b35acf
spent
true